Carpet has always been a classic and comfortable choice for many spaces, but it can look especially chic when used in a wall-to-wall installation. Often referred to as "broadloom" carpeting, this type of flooring comes in long, wide rolls and covers an entire space in one or a few pieces. This creates a seamless look for which it is known.

Typically, carpet broadloom is laid on underfelt over the substrate flooring and then attached with small tacks. Some are made to stick directly on subfloors while others require a layer of padding or underlayment to help with the durability of the carpet. While you're shopping for carpeting, you may also need to consider other factors such as the room's intended use and how much foot traffic it will receive. It's also a good idea to keep color, design and fibre type in mind when you're selecting carpet.
In addition to considering the style of the carpet, you'll need to think about the construction of the carpet, which includes how it's tufted or woven and what kind of primary backing it has. There are some tufted carpets that have a high-performance primary backing, such as action back, which is extremely durable and helps to reduce static. Other primary backings for carpets are more luxurious, such as jute and sisal, or have anti-static and fire resistance properties.

It's always a good idea to have a professional installer install your carpeting so that it is stretched properly and fitted tightly against the floor to avoid a loose, disheveled look and ensure that there are no uncovered areas from measurement mishaps. Ultimately, this is an investment in your property and should be treated as such.
